Enhanced Security Through Comprehensive Video Surveillance
Multi-Channel Recording Capabilities
Modern delivery vehicles require surveillance coverage from multiple angles to ensure complete security protection. An MDVR monitoring and management system typically features four or more channels that capture footage from strategic positions around the vehicle, including the cargo area, driver compartment, and exterior views. This comprehensive coverage eliminates blind spots that criminals often exploit during theft attempts or fraudulent liability claims. The high-definition recording quality ensures that license plates, faces, and other critical details remain clearly visible even in challenging lighting conditions. Multiple camera angles also provide valuable evidence for insurance claims and legal proceedings, protecting delivery companies from false accusations and costly settlements.
The simultaneous recording capability of professional MDVR systems ensures that all camera feeds are synchronized with accurate timestamps and GPS coordinates. This synchronization proves crucial during incident investigations, allowing security personnel and law enforcement to reconstruct events with precise detail. Advanced systems also include motion detection features that trigger automatic recording when unauthorized access is detected, conserving storage space while maintaining security coverage during parked periods. The redundant recording architecture ensures data integrity even if individual camera components experience technical issues, maintaining continuous surveillance protection throughout delivery operations.
Real-Time Video Monitoring and Management Awareness
Maintaining security during delivery operations depends on clear, continuous visibility of vehicles and on-road conditions. Modern MDVR monitoring and management system solutions provide real-time video streaming combined with GPS tracking, enabling fleet managers to observe vehicle status, driving behavior, and surrounding environments through a centralized management platform.
By reviewing live video feeds and route information in the backend system, managers can promptly identify abnormal situations such as unexpected stops, suspicious activity around the vehicle, or irregular driving behavior. This real-time operational awareness supports timely decision-making and allows managers to provide guidance to drivers when necessary.
With support for mobile communication networks, the system ensures stable data transmission across urban and remote delivery routes, allowing consistent monitoring throughout the journey. Adjustable monitoring settings help fleet operators adapt the system to different routes, vehicle types, and cargo requirements, supporting efficient and secure operations.
In addition, the system enables event review and driver-initiated communication, allowing important situations to be documented and handled through the management platform. This approach improves delivery safety, operational transparency, and overall fleet control.

Legal Protection and Risk Mitigation Strategies
Insurance Claim Documentation and Fraud Prevention
Delivery vehicles face elevated risk exposure due to frequent stops in diverse neighborhoods and extended road time that increases accident probability. Professional MDVR monitoring and management system installations provide comprehensive documentation that protects companies from fraudulent insurance claims and liability disputes. High-quality video evidence eliminates uncertainty regarding fault determination in traffic accidents, often resulting in faster claim resolution and reduced legal expenses. Insurance companies increasingly recognize the value of comprehensive video documentation, frequently offering premium discounts for fleets equipped with professional surveillance systems.
The tamper-resistant design of quality MDVR systems ensures that recorded evidence maintains legal admissibility in court proceedings and insurance investigations. Encrypted storage and chain-of-custody features prevent unauthorized access or manipulation of critical evidence files. Multiple backup systems and cloud storage integration provide redundant data protection that ensures evidence availability even if primary storage devices are damaged during incidents. These robust evidence preservation capabilities have proven instrumental in defending against false liability claims that could otherwise result in substantial financial settlements.
Regulatory Compliance and Documentation Requirements
Transportation and delivery companies must navigate complex regulatory environments that impose strict documentation and safety requirements. MDVR monitoring and management system solutions automate compliance reporting by maintaining detailed records of driver hours, vehicle speeds, and route adherence that regulatory agencies require. Automated logbook generation eliminates manual record-keeping errors while ensuring complete documentation coverage that satisfies audit requirements. GPS tracking integration provides precise location verification that supports Hours of Service compliance and route authorization documentation.
Environmental regulations and safety standards continue expanding in scope and complexity, requiring delivery companies to demonstrate ongoing compliance through comprehensive documentation. Advanced MDVR systems integrate with vehicle diagnostic systems to monitor emissions levels, safety equipment functionality, and other regulated parameters. Automated reporting capabilities generate compliance summaries that streamline regulatory submissions and audit preparations. The comprehensive data retention capabilities ensure that historical compliance records remain accessible throughout required retention periods, protecting companies from regulatory penalties and operational restrictions.

What are the primary components included in a complete MDVR monitoring and management system?
A complete MDVR monitoring and management system typically includes multiple high-definition cameras, a car black box recording host with HDD/SSD/SD for storage, 4G function,GPS tracking module, wireless communication capabilities, and management software. Professional systems also include impact sensors, panic buttons, and backup power supplies to ensure continuous operation. The recording unit processes multiple camera feeds simultaneously while maintaining synchronized timestamps and location data for each recorded event.

Can MDVR systems operate effectively in areas with poor cellular coverage?
Modern MDVR monitoring and management system designs include local storage capabilities that ensure continuous recording even when wireless connectivity is unavailable. The systems automatically synchronize stored data with central servers when connectivity is restored, ensuring no operational data is lost. Advanced units may include multiple communication options such as WiFi connectivity to maintain reliable data transmission in challenging coverage areas.
What maintenance requirements are associated with MDVR monitoring systems?
MDVR monitoring and management system maintenance primarily involves regular cleaning of camera lenses, periodic software updates, and routine inspection of cable connections. Hard drive replacement may be required every 2-3 years depending on usage intensity and environmental conditions. Professional systems are designed for minimal maintenance requirements with most components rated for extended service life in demanding mobile environments. Regular system health monitoring alerts administrators to potential issues before they impact operational performance.
